Bosch Security Systems B921C Keypad Installation Guide

Below you will find brief information for Keypad B921C. The B921C keypad is a SDI2 bus compatible device, which means that it can connect to the control panel using terminal wiring and that you can connect more than one keypad to the control panel by wiring them in parallel. This keypad has user adjustable options such as volume and display brightness, and an LCD display that shows two-line system messages.

Key features

  • SDI2 bus compatible
  • Adjustable volume and display brightness
  • LCD display with two-line system messages
  • Capacitive keys
  • Up to 4 inputs
  • Surface and wall mount
  • Address switches for configuration
  • Sensor loop monitoring
  • Status indicators and audible tones
  • Firmware version check

Set the address switches according to the control panel configuration. Each SDI2 keypad must have a unique address.

Connect the detection devices to the keypad terminals labeled for 1, 2, 3, 4, and COM. Wire resistance on each sensor loop must be less than 100 Ω with the detection devices connected.

Press [MENU] to open the Main menu, and follow the instructions to adjust the brightness level.

Press [MENU] to open the Main menu, and follow the instructions to turn the nightlight on or off.

Refer to the table of status indicators and their meanings to understand system status.

Remove the keypad from the base to remove power and then return it to the base to restore power. The keypad will display the firmware version for 10 seconds.

Use a soft cloth and non-abrasive cleaning solution (for example, microfiber cloth and eyeglass cleaner). Spray the cleaner onto the cloth and do not spray cleaners directly onto the keypad.
